Eleazar: NCR police ready for SONA

By Pearl Gumapos

Philippine National Police (PNP) Chief Police Gen. Guillermo Eleazar assured the public that the National Capital Region Police Office (NCRPO) has started security preparations for President Rodrigo Duterte’s last State of the Nation Address (SONA).

“Palapit nang palapit ang SONA ng ating Pangulo, at batid ng inyong PNP ang matinding interes ng ating mga kababayan sa kanyang mensahe, kaya naman patuloy ang aming paghahanda para dito,” Eleazar said in a press release.

“Naging tahimik at maayos ang mga nakalipas na SONA ng ating Pangulo, at ito ang nagsisilbing template ng inyong kapulisan sa darating na Hulyo 26, kabilang ang maayos na pakikipag-usap sa lahat ng grupo,” he added.

Eleazar previously ensured zero casualties and zero incidents during the President’s first two SONAs in 2016 and 2017 as Task Group Quezon Commander, and two other SONAs as NCRPO director and head of Security Task Force SONA.

He was the commander of Joint Task Force COVID Shield during the President’s fifth SONA last year.

It was Eleazar’s idea to remove container vans and other barricades which had been present at all other SONAs, arguing that their presence only invited aggressiveness on the part of the protesters. He instead pushed for dialogues with various groups.

The police are also coordinating with other offices and stakeholders to determine the setup of Duterte’s last SONA, given that there is still a pandemic in the country, Eleazar said.

He urged groups planning to hold mass actions to reconsider and to just conduct their activities online to avoid contracting COVID-19.

“We encourage these groups planning to conduct mass actions to coordinate their activities with the PNP. Pero mas makabubuti sana kung gawin na lamang nilang virtual ang kanilang mga activities, para na din sa kaligtasan ng lahat mula sa COVID-19, lalo na’t nakapasok na sa ating bansa ang mas nakahahawang Delta variant,” he said.

The PNP chief assured that no security threat has been detected for President Duterte’s SONA on July 26.

However, he said the police force will be on full alert and enough police officers will be deployed to guard against untoward incidents on that day. – jlo
